The Chief of Army Staff (COAS), Lieutenant General Olufemi Oluyede, has approved the posting and redeployment of senior officers to key command, instructional, and staff positions across the Nigerian Army.

According to a statement by the Acting Deputy Director of Army Public Relations, Lieutenant Colonel Apolonia Anele, the reshuffle affects some Principal Staff Officers at the Army Headquarters, two General Officers Commanding (GOCs), Corps Commanders, Commandants of training institutions, and Brigade Commanders, among others.

At the Army Headquarters, Major General AA Adeyinka was appointed Chief of Logistics (Army), Major General AA Adekeye became Chief of Personnel Management (Army), while Major General TB Ugiagbe was named Chief of Standard and Evaluation. Also, Major General AA Idris was appointed Chief of Military Intelligence, and Major General MO Erebulu became Provost Marshal (Army).

For field commands, Major General ASM Wase is now GOC 1 Division and Commander Sector 1 Joint Task Force North West Operation FANSAN YAMMA, while Major General CR Nnebeife takes over as GOC 2 Division/Sector 3 of the same operation.

Training institutions also received new heads, including Major General MO Ihanuwaze at the Nigerian Army Finance School, Major General KO Osemwegie at the Army Signal School, Major General AJ Aliyu at the Ordnance School, and Major General AC Adetoba at the Nigerian Army College of Logistics and Management.

Other appointments include Brigadier General M Jimoh to 1 Brigade, Brigadier General NE Okoloagu to 2 Brigade, and Brigadier General AA Bello to 6 Division Garrison/Sector 3 JTF South South Operation DELTA SAFE.

Lieutenant General Oluyede urged the newly appointed officers to redouble efforts in the fight against terrorism, insurgency, and other threats to national security, while reiterating his commitment to prioritising troop welfare.
